Transaction 336e1586349c2e59a80176515f3f421d8e40a28fe7b783eb6c34b4724b935dbd

1 Input
2 Outputs
  • 336e1586349c2e59a80176515f3f421d8e40a28fe7b783eb6c34b4724b935dbd:0
  • value  16955966
    address  3McGE2cEnv38q2yYsWdzNWxUyKyJcDSUti
  • 336e1586349c2e59a80176515f3f421d8e40a28fe7b783eb6c34b4724b935dbd:1
  • value  3218795530
    address  3C8qRRxfXnLFum3f4PVSZZcqEShSB6nukQ